How Do I Make a New Tail for my Pony?


Making new tails, or securing your original MLP ones is easy! Here's what to do:


Step 1: Buy some plastic zip/cable ties like the one below:

Step 2: If you are working with an existing tail and the old washer and clamp are still attached, remove them using 2 pairs of pliers:

If you're working with new hair, you can skip this step.




Step 3: Wrap a tie around the middle of your tail, and cinch it tight. Now pull the ends of the tail until they are even.

Step 4: Loop another zip tie around the leftover portion of the first tie, and slide it down over the base of the tail. Cinch it tight.

Step 5: Clip the excess from the ties and you've got a new tail! Because it's plastic, you don't have to worry about it rusting or degrading over time, and no more rattling ponies either!


Step 6: Take a 12" length of thin wire or ribbon and fold it in half. Insert the folded end through the tail hole so that it eventually comes out of the neck hole, with the unfolded ends still protruding from the tail hole.




Pull your tail halfway through the loop of wire just outside of the neck hole.




Using needle-nose pliers, pull the loose ends of wire outside the tail hole (this takes elbow grease!) until the tail pops through the hole. Pull the loose half of the tail through the hole until the zip ties are just inside the tail hole, and the tail looks complete.
